Output 687f2733931b2ab8445fad99b8051e1ec0b72a8fe5f43d52ee5b7f261bfb92cc:0

value
1775608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f395e06712d55656d130f1451efc78d878f628 OP_EQUAL
address
34y7NsXYb7xRq5qRxjznLjnNEtJCifpWUi
transaction
687f2733931b2ab8445fad99b8051e1ec0b72a8fe5f43d52ee5b7f261bfb92cc
spent
true